"A new wine shop opened by the Noble Rot team on Lamb’s Conduit Street in Bloomsbury, established as part of their Keeling Andrew & Co. import business and reflecting the wines featured in the group's magazine and restaurants. In addition to a focused wine selection it stocks merchandise, magazines and books, and its logos and shop art were created by long‑time collaborator Jose Miguel Mendez (who also designed the label for the house 'Chin Chin' wine). The inventory emphasizes mature classics from Burgundy, Bordeaux, Rioja and Brunello, sought‑after grower Champagne and up‑and‑coming natural producers; highlighted bottles include François Rousset‑Martin’s lightly oxidative 'Cuvée Professor' 2018 (£58) and Justin Dutraive’s Fleurie 'La Madone' 2019 (£43). The retail launch was accelerated by the pandemic: as an importer the owners could leverage an existing stockholding but required new premises, staff and systems to service private customers to their desired standard." - Adam Coghlan
